The jury's out on how good a podcaster I am.

Today we're talking about a piece of vocabulary that we can use to say that we haven't decided what our opinion is yet. We're still thinking about a topic and deciding what we think of it. This is the idiom "the jury is (still) out". I hope you find it useful!
